Snowman Cake Pops

Snowman Cake Pops
Snowman Cake Pops might be just the hor d'oeuvre you are searching for. This recipe makes 48 servings with 151 calories, 5g of protein, and 6g of fat each. This recipe covers 1% of your daily requirements of vitamins and minerals. From preparation to the plate, this recipe takes roughly 1 hour and 30 minutes. If you have lollipop sticks, sprinkles, cream cheese frosting, and a few other ingredients on hand, you can make it.
